LUNAR-IRRADIANCE
Lunar spectral irradiance measurement and modelling for absoloute calibration of EO optical sensors
This project focuses on the precise measurement and modelling of lunar spectral irradiance to enable the absolute radiometric calibration of Earth-observation optical sensors. By combining advanced lunar radiometry, improved irradiance models, and dedicated calibration strategies, the project enhances the accuracy, stability, and long-term traceability of satellite sensor calibration for Earth-observation missions.
